While there are some car buyers who are just looking for the vehicle with the sexiest design or best sound-sounding engine, the truth is most people shopping for a new car are looking for something that rides comfortably, has a nice interior, and is affordable.

That’s where Autotrader’s annual 10 Best Car Interiors Under $50,000 list comes into play.

Every year, the editors at Autotrader put together a list of new cars with the most luxurious, modern, and comfortable cabins at the aforementioned price point. As you might have gathered by the headline of this article, the 2017 Cadillac XT5 was included on Autotrader’s list for 2017.

With an MSRP of $39,395, the entry-level Cadillac XT5 boasts a spacious and tech-savvy cabin, which editors from Autotrader praised for its well-organized infotainment system, eye-catching dashboard, and comfortable seats. In addition, Cadillac’s official site claims that the XT5 provides class-leading legroom for both front and rear passengers, and also offers up to 63 cubic feet of storage space.

In case you didn’t already know, the Cadillac XT5 is all-new for the 2017 model year, as it replaced the company’s SRX crossover, which previously served as Cadillac’s best-selling model around the world. However, the XT5 has a 2-inch longer wheelbase than the SRX, giving it more interior space for passengers.

The 2017 Cadillac XT5 comes standard with a rearvision camera, a hand-crafted cut-and-sewn interior, Okapi deco wood trim, Bose 8-speaker premium audio system, wireless charging, dual-zone climate control, and the Cadillac CUE infotainment system with an 8-inch touchscreen that’s compatible with both Android Auto and Apple CarPlay.

“You could argue that a car’s interior appeal is even more important than its exterior styling, given that most drivers spend far more time experiencing their car from the inside,” said Managing Editor of Autotrader Tara Trompeter in a statement. “That’s why it is so important to find a comfortable interior that works well for your personal preferences and needs.”
